GOOD PRACTICE GUIDE
The CPA Australia Good Practice Guide is now live and only CPA Australia members and FEI members have access to it. The Guide is an online library of procedures, policies and typical documents used in the financial management of a company. The documents have come from a variety of sources, including our own members. The aim is to provide practical tools to help financial executives with their day-to-day work, to help members avoid “reinventing the wheel” and enable comparison of their own documents and procedures with those from other sources.
